Home Assistant має вбудований інструмент для створення зображень за допомогою штучного інтелекту. Функція “AI Task” існує з 2025 року, а генерація зображень була додана в Home Assistant 2025.10. Проте, ви, можливо, ще не знаєте про її можливості. Освоївши її, ви зможете знайти їй чимало застосувань.
Розблокуйте персоналізований контент та
ексклюзивні функції Безкоштовно
- Беріть участь в обговореннях у Threads
- Слідкуйте та ставьте лайки топ-авторам, темам та трендам
- Переглядайте контент з меншою кількістю реклами на сайті
- Персоналізуйте свій профіль, щоб демонструвати свою активність
- Отримуйте стрічку контенту, адаптовану до ваших інтересів
Створюючи обліковий запис, ви погоджуєтеся з нашими Умовами використання та Політикою конфіденційності. Ви також погоджуєтеся отримувати наші розсилки; від підписки можна відмовитися будь-коли.
Продовжити читання
Увійти
Забули пароль?
Створити обліковий запис
Будь ласка, вкажіть свою електронну адресу, щоб завершити створення облікового запису.
Створити обліковий запис
*Обов’язково: 8 символів, 1 велика літера, 1 цифра
Створити обліковий запис
або
Продовжити
Створюючи обліковий запис, ви погоджуєтеся з нашими Умовами використання та Політикою конфіденційності. Ви також погоджуєтеся отримувати наші розсилки; від підписки можна відмовитися будь-коли.
AI Task — це інтеграція-будівельний блок
Для її використання потрібні інші інтеграції
Причина, чому ви могли не натрапити на функцію генерації зображень у Home Assistant, полягає в тому, що вона є частиною інтеграції-будівельного блоку. Інтеграцію “AI Task” неможливо додати безпосередньо до вашого екземпляра Home Assistant, як стандартні інтеграції; це інструмент, який надається іншим інтеграціям для використання.
Існує дві основні дії для інтеграції “AI Task”. Дія `ai_task.generate_data` може використовувати підключену велику мовну модель (LLM) для генерації даних на основі запиту. Дія `ai_task.generate_image` створює зображення за допомогою штучного інтелекту на основі наданого запиту.
Щоб скористатися цими діями, вам потрібно використовувати інтеграцію, яка їх підтримує. Наприклад, інтеграція OpenAI може використовувати ці дії для генерації даних або зображень, застосовуючи моделі OpenAI для отримання тексту чи зображень відповідно до ваших інструкцій.
Підключення постачальника ШІ
Основні варіанти потребують витрат на API
Для використання генерації зображень у Home Assistant найпростішими варіантами є використання однієї з підтримуваних інтеграцій зі штучним інтелектом. Існує кілька інтеграцій, які ви можете використовувати. Інтеграція OpenAI дозволяє використовувати деякі з тих самих моделей, що й ChatGPT, хоча для генерації зображень наразі неможливо використовувати флагманську модель GPT Image 2.
Іншим основним варіантом є інтеграція Google Gemini. Ви можете використовувати її для створення зображень за допомогою моделей штучного інтелекту Google. Вона використовує модель `gemini-2.5-flash-preview-image`.
Використання будь-якої з цих інтеграцій вимагатиме оплати за API, навіть якщо у вас є підписка на Gemini або ChatGPT. Витрати зазвичай низькі для епізодичного використання, хоча точна вартість залежить від постачальника та моделі, яку ви використовуєте.
Існують способи локальної генерації зображень; інтеграція HACS дозволяє генерувати зображення локально за допомогою ComfyUI, але це вимагає достатньо потужного обладнання для обробки генерації зображень локально. Перевагою є те, що локальна генерація зображень є не тільки більш приватною, але й безкоштовною.
Після налаштування інтеграції ви можете використовувати дію `ai_task.generate_image` у своїх автоматизаціях для створення зображень. Вам потрібно вказати запит як атрибут `instructions` і вибрати відповідне завдання LLM як `entity_id`, наприклад, `ai_task.google_ai_task`.
Adam Davidson
Що можна робити з генерацією зображень у Home Assistant
Це може бути справді корисним
Генерація зображень за допомогою штучного інтелекту не здається чимось, що неодмінно буде корисним у вашому розумному домі. Однак, існує безліч способів, як це може бути корисним.
Однією з моїх улюблених речей, налаштованих на iPhone, є віджет, який відображає зображення поточних місцевих погодних умов, згенероване ChatGPT. Усе це працює через ярлик iOS, і це чудовий спосіб швидко побачити, яка погода. Найкраще те, що під час подорожей зображення показує поточне місцезнаходження, а не мій дім.
Я використав генерацію зображень у Home Assistant для створення подібної функції. Кожні дві години вдень автоматизація перевіряє поточну погоду та використовує Gemini для створення зображення, що відображає поточні погодні умови. Якщо умови не змінилися, нове зображення не генерується, щоб заощадити на витратах API.
Ви також можете використовувати зображення, згенеровані ШІ, для візуального зворотного зв’язку про стан вашого розумного дому, або для створення власних зображень для сповіщень Home Assistant. Якщо у вас є панель керування, закріплена на стіні, вона може відображати зображення, згенеровані ШІ, коли ви нею не користуєтеся, або додавати графіку та зображення до вашого календаря, що стосуються майбутніх подій.
Оскільки моделі ШІ можуть генерувати майже все, що ви забажаєте, справжні межі — це ваша уява. Зображення часто може передати інформацію набагато легше, ніж довге сповіщення.
Відображення згенерованих зображень на ваших панелях керування
Запис результату в картку зображення (Picture Card)
Генерування зображень — це чудово, але за замовчуванням вони потрапляють у вкладку “Медіа” Home Assistant. Один з найкращих способів їх відобразити — це використання панелі керування.
Підпишіться на розсилку для практичних порад щодо ШІ-зображень
Отримуйте практичні поради щодо налаштування, економні робочі процеси та приклади для панелей керування, підписавшись на розсилку. Вона робить генерацію зображень за допомогою ШІ в Home Assistant практичною завдяки чітким інструкціям, запитам та ідеям конфігурації, які ви можете застосувати до свого розумного дому. Отримувати оновлення Підписуючись, ви погоджуєтеся отримувати розсилки та маркетингові електронні листи, а також приймаєте наші Умови використання та Політику конфіденційності. Від підписки можна відмовитися будь-коли.
Виявляється, це створює невеликі проблеми. Зображення зберігаються постійно, тому ви завжди можете знайти їх у медіа-браузері. Проте, ви не можете використовувати `media_source_id` для відображення зображень на панелі керування. Посилання, яке генерує Home Assistant, містить одноразовий токен безпеки, який з часом закінчується.
Панель керування не використовує цю URL безпосередньо; вона використовує власний проксі-сервер зображень Home Assistant, тому зображення продовжуватиме відображатися після закінчення терміну дії токена безпеки. Єдина проблема виникає при перезапуску Home Assistant; сутність шаблону втрачає відстеження зображення, яке відображалося, тому панель керування стає порожньою до наступної генерації зображення.
Зображення, згенеровані ШІ, можуть стати частиною вашого розумного дому
Створення персоналізованих зображень для вашого розумного дому може бути дуже корисним. Зображення зберігаються за замовчуванням, тому вам може знадобитися провести певне очищення, якщо ваші резервні копії Home Assistant почнуть ставати надто великими. Хоча вам доводиться платити за використання хмарних моделей, витрати досить низькі, якщо ви не створюєте сотні зображень на день.
Порада від Soft Portal: Функція генерації зображень за допомогою ШІ в Home Assistant відкриває нові креативні можливості для візуалізації даних вашого розумного дому, від інформативних погодних віджетів до унікальних сповіщень. Хоча для її використання потрібні певні технічні налаштування та інтеграції, потенціал для персоналізації та покращення користувацького досвіду робить цю функцію вартісною уваги.
Дізнатися більше на: www.howtogeek.com
